Maeve is derived from the Old Irish name Medb, which means 'intoxicating' or 'she who intoxicates'. In Irish mythology, Queen Maeve (Medb) was a powerful and legendary warrior queen of Connacht. The name has seen a resurgence in popularity in recent years, particularly in English-speaking countries.
